Roger J. "Chip" Hilarides

Senior Vice President -- Compliance, Ethics and EHS
 
Roger Hilarides

Georgia-Pacific

2009-Present Senior Vice President - Compliance, Ethics and EHS 2008-2009 Senior Director - Environmental Affairs 2004-2008 General Manager - Bellingham Operations 2002-2004 Senior Environmental Consultant 2001-2002 Environmental Manager - Bellingham Operations 1998-2001 Senior Environmental Engineer

Previous Positions

1994-1997 Lieutenant Commander, USN, Engineer Officer Henry M. Jackson (SSBN 730 Blue) 1991-1994 Lieutenant, USN, Instructor of Naval Science, University of Notre Dame 1989-1991 Junior Officer, USS Chicago (SSN 721)

Former Affiliations

  Northwest Pulp and Paper Association - member of the Board of Trustees and Technical Committee member   Junior Achievement of Washington - board member   Bellingham/Whatcom Economic Development Council - board member   Bellingham School District Strategic Steering Committee - member   Nooksack Salmon Enhancement Association - board member   Whatcom Day Academy Board of Trustees - member   Western Washington University Foundation Board Member

Education

  Doctor of Philosophy, Environmental Engineering, University of Notre Dame, 1994   Bachelor of Science, Marine Engineering, United States Naval Academy, 1987

Honors

  University of Notre Dame Outstanding Graduate Student in Engineering - 1994   Navy Commendation Medal (3 awards) - 1989 to 1997   Navy Achievement Medal (2 awards) - 1989 to 1995   Kuwaiti Liberation Medal - 1991   Southwest Asia Service Medal - 1991   Navy Expeditionary Medal   U.S. Naval Academy Outstanding Naval Engineer award - 1987   U.S. Naval Academy Trident Scholar - 1987
